Flyweight – Joseph Benavidez

Greatest UFC fighters that never won a title

Joseph Benavidez is widely regarded as one of the greatest fighters to have never won a UFC title. Despite having four opportunities to claim the belt, two against Demetrious Johnson, one against Deiveson Figueiredo and one against Dominick Cruz, he was unable to secure a victory. Nevertheless, his record remains impressive and he has only ever been defeated by top-tier fighters.

Benavidez is renowned for his unwavering determination and fighting spirit, as demonstrated by his refusal to tap out during his fight with Figueiredo, even as he was blacking out. He is widely considered to be a future UFC Hall of Famer and a true legend of the sport.

Bantamweight – Marlon Moraes

Marlon Moraes best bantamweight to never win title

Despite never winning a world title, Marlon Moraes has victories over some legendary UFC champions. Fighters like Jose Aldo, Aljamain Sterling and Raphael Assuncou all fell victim to his skills. However, unfortunately for Moraes, none of those bouts were for the title.

Featherweight – The Korean Zombie

Best featherweight to never win the UFC title

Chan Sung Jung, also known as “The Korean Zombie,” still competes in the Featherweight division of the Ultimate Fighting Championship. Throughout his career, he has achieved several impressive victories against top fighters such as Frankie Edgar, Renato Moicano, Dennis Bermudez and Dustin Poirier.

Jung’s nickname “The Korean Zombie” comes from his ability to continue fighting aggressively while eating punches. He is a true warrior in the octagon and one of the best UFC fighters that never became champion.

Lightweight – Tony Ferguson

Best lightweight in the ufc to never become champion

In his prime, Tony Ferguson managed to go on a 12 fight win streak in the UFC and still not win the title. It’s as impressive as it is disappointing for El Cucuy.

Throughout his historic winning run, Ferguson beat the who’s who of the lightweight division including 2 former champions in Rafael Dos Anjos and Anthony “Showtime” Pettis.

Although he is still competing today, unfortunately it looks as if Tony’s best days are behind him as he has been on a bit of a losing run recently.

Middleweight – Yoel Romero

Best fighters to never win a UFC title

Yoel Romero can only be described as a freak of nature. In a good way of course. The Cuban came within a split decision loss against Robert Whittaker to never lift UFC gold.

Although the Soldier of God never won a UFC belt, he does have some impressive wins on his resume. Luke Rockhold, Lyoto Machida and former Middleweight champion Chris Weidman just to name a few. Yoel Romero is undoubtedly the best UFC middleweight to never become champion.

Heavyweight – Alistair Overeem

Best heavyweight to never win a UFC belt

Dutchman Alistair Overeem is a former K-1 fighter and one of the greatest UFC heavyweights of all time. Unfortunately for him though he never quite managed to get his hands on UFC gold.

He did however beat FIVE former UFC heavyweight champions during his run. Yes, five! Brock Lesnar, Frank Mir, Fabricio Werdum, Andrei Arlovski and Junior Dos Santos were all defeated at the hands of Overeem.
